Fantasy Poem by Brian James Caffrey

Fantasy

Rating: 5.0


The light of the moon shining,
Stars twinkling in the night sky each one competing for our affection.
A lake with two swans gently gliding over,
This shimmering silver landscape of the still waters,
Necks intertwined.
Silence envelopes the surroundings,
Save the gentle flow of a small water fall in the distance,
The waves gently caressing the shore as we view this masterpiece of creation.
This is your beauty,
This is my fantasy,
Make of it what you will,
But don’t change
